황사가 심한 날씨인대 고생 안하시는지 모르겠네요 ^^
방법을 찾아보다 이렇게 질문을 남기게 되네요.
PERFORM 을 탈때 인터널 TABLE을 USING 할려고 하는대요..
여기서 USING 할 인터널 테이블이 STANDARD TABLE 에 구조가 아닌
따로 구성한 인터널 TABLE 이라 PREFORM에 먹히질 않내요..
F1 눌러서 보니 ITAB 는 STANDARD TABLE 에 형식이어야 한다는 것 같은데..
잘못 알고 있는것인지.. 그게 아니라면 힌트 부탁 드리겠습니다..
3-5-3. TABLES 구문
TABLES 구문은 Rel 3.0 이전 버전에서 사용되는 것으로 USING과 CHANGING 구문 대신에 사용 가능하다. 호환성 문제 때문에 현재도 많이 사용되고 있다.
<BOX>
FORM <subr> TABLES ... <itabi> [TYPE <t>|LIKE <f>] ...
</BOX>
Formal 파라미터인 <itabi>은 Header Line 이 존재하는 Standard 인터널 테이블로 정의되어야 한다. 만약 Actual 파라미터에서 Header Line이 존재하지 않는 인터널 테이블을 사용하였다면, 시스템은 자동으로 Formal 파라미터를 위해 Local Header Line을 생성하게 된다. TABLES 구문을 이용하여 Formal 파라미터를 정의하였다면 by reference가 지원되지 않는다.